Director of Nursing (DON)Sign on Bonus : $7,500POSITION
SUMMARYThe Director of Nursing is accountable for the development
and maintenance of nursing service objective and standards of
nursing practice. Has administrative authority, responsibility and
accountability for functions, activities, and training of nursing
staff. Is responsible for the planning, development, and
implementation of care delivery systems. Orients, instructs, and
supervises personnel and functions. Coordinates nursing services
with other departments. Maintains supplies and adequate equipment.
Maintains compliance with Federal, State, and local standards and
regulations to assure quality outcome of care.ESSENTIAL

and weekends as directed by supervisor.QUALIFICATIONSEducation and
ExperienceMust be a Registered Nurse, currently licensed by the
State of Minnesota, who has training in rehabilitation nursing,
gerontology, nursing service administration, management,
supervision and psychiatric or geriatric nursing before or within
the first twelve (12) months after appointment as Director of
Nursing Services.Must possess the ability to communicate verbally
and in writing when directing the care of residents.Must be able to
perform essential functions of the position with or without
reasonable accommodation.Must qualify for employment, after
criminal background study, per guidelines of Minnesota Department
of Human Services.PreferredExperience in healthcare, skilled
